What We Do
CaptivateIQ is on a journey to modernize the world of incentive compensation. Our hope is that people will feel more connected at work if there is greater transparency in how they are rewarded for their efforts. We believe that getting paid should be fun and that work should be a breeze for compensation plan administrators. That’s why we’ve created a robust, flexible commission management platform that enables sales, finance, and operations teams to sync their data, design any plan, and build workflows that work best for their organization.
